Painting Description
Leopold Kupelwieser, an Austrian painter associated with the Biedermeier period, is known for his detailed and emotive works that often capture the essence of 19th-century European life. One of his notable paintings, "Handleserin Und Vornehme Junge Italienerin Mit Laute In Landschaft," exemplifies his skill in portraying both human figures and landscapes with a delicate touch and keen attention to detail.
The painting's title, which translates to "Fortune Teller and Noble Young Italian Woman with Lute in Landscape," provides insight into its subject matter. The composition features two central figures: a fortune teller and a young Italian woman, set against a picturesque landscape. The fortune teller, depicted with an air of mystery and wisdom, is engaged in reading the palm of the young woman, who is elegantly dressed and holds a lute, suggesting her noble status and cultural refinement.
Kupelwieser's use of color and light in this painting is particularly noteworthy. The warm, earthy tones of the landscape contrast with the more vibrant hues of the figures' clothing, drawing the viewer's eye to the interaction between the two women. The detailed rendering of the lute and the intricate patterns of the young woman's attire highlight Kupelwieser's meticulous approach to his craft.
The landscape itself, with its rolling hills and serene atmosphere, serves as a tranquil backdrop that enhances the intimate moment shared between the fortune teller and the young woman. This setting not only situates the figures within a specific geographical context but also adds a layer of narrative depth, suggesting themes of fate, destiny, and the intersection of different social classes.
"Handleserin Und Vornehme Junge Italienerin Mit Laute In Landschaft" is a testament to Kupelwieser's ability to blend narrative and visual elements seamlessly. Through this work, he captures a moment of cultural and personal significance, inviting viewers to ponder the stories and lives of the individuals depicted. This painting remains an important example of Kupelwieser's contribution to the Biedermeier art movement and his enduring legacy in the world of 19th-century European art.
